📜  重命名列 sql (1)

📅  最后修改于: 2023-12-03 15:28:31.359000             🧑  作者: Mango

重命名列 SQL

在 SQL 中,我们可能需要对表的某一列进行重命名。这是非常常见的操作,可以通过以下语法实现:

ALTER TABLE table_name
RENAME COLUMN old_column_name TO new_column_name;

其中,table_name 是需要重命名列的表名,old_column_name 是需要重命名的列名,new_column_name 是新的列名。

例如,我们需要将表 students 中的 name 列重命名为 full_name,可以使用以下 SQL 语句:

ALTER TABLE students
RENAME COLUMN name TO full_name;

需要注意的是,这种操作会改变表结构,可能会影响到表中的数据。因此,在执行重命名列操作之前,请务必备份表数据,并确认重命名操作不会影响到现有的查询逻辑。

在某些数据库中,也可以使用 AS 关键字来重命名列,例如 MySQL:

SELECT name AS full_name
FROM students;

这种方式不会改变表结构,但只对查询语句中的列名有效,不会影响表中实际存储的数据。

无论使用哪种方式,重命名列都是一种非常有用的操作,可以帮助我们更好地管理和使用数据库中的数据。